Summer Squash Stir Fry with Beef Featuring Beef Bou

This quick and easy stir fry pairs tender slices of beef sirloin or flank steak with vibrant summer squash, zucchini, red bell pepper, and onion, creating a colorful and nutrient-packed dish. Enhanced with the rich, savory depth of Beef Bou Concentrate and a drizzle of sesame oil, the stir fry boasts bold umami flavors in every bite. A simple marinade of soy sauce and cornstarch ensures juicy, perfectly seasoned beef, while a touch of garlic and optional red pepper flakes add just the right amount of kick. Ready in just 35 minutes, this versatile recipe is perfect served over rice or noodles, making it a satisfying, wholesome meal for the whole family.

🥘 Ingredients

15 items
  • 1 pound beef sirloin or flank steak
  • 2 medium yellow squash
  • 2 medium zucchini
  • 1 large red bell pepper
  • 1 small onion
  • 3 cloves minced garlic
  • 1 piece Beef Bou Concentrate or Bouillon Cube
  • 3 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 2 tablespoons dark sesame oil
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
  • 1 tablespoon cornstarch
  • 1 cup water
  • 0.25 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 0.25 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)
  •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ley or cilantro (optional, for garnish)

📝 Instructions

11 steps
1

Trim any excess fat from the beef, then slice it thinly against the grain into bite-sized strips.

2

In a mixing bowl, combine soy sauce, 1 tablespoon of sesame oil, cornstarch, and 1/4 cup water. Add the sliced beef to the bowl and let it marinate for 10 minutes while you prepare the vegetables.

3

Wash the squash, zucchini, red bell pepper, and onion. Slice the squash and zucchini into thin half-moons, the bell pepper into strips, and the onion into small wedges.

4

Heat 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at. Add the beef and stir-fry for about 3-4 minutes or until it's browned but not fully cooked. Remove the beef from the skillet and set it aside.

5

In the same skillet, heat the remaining vegetable oil. Add onion and bell pepper, and stir-fry for 2 minutes.

6

Add the minced garlic, summer squash, and zucchini to the skillet. Stir-fry for an additional 4-5 minutes until the vegetables are tender-crisp.

7

In a small bowl, mix the Beef Bou Concentrate (or crush the bouillon cube) with the remaining 3/4 cup water and stir until dissolved.

8

Pour the bouillon mixture into the skillet along with the beef, ground black pepper, and red pepper flakes, if using. Toss everything together to combine.

9

Reduce the heat to medium and let it simmer for 2-3 minutes, or until the beef is cooked through and the sauce thickens slightly.

10

Drizzle with the remaining sesame oil, and garnish with fresh parsley or cilantro, if desired.

11

Serve hot over steamed rice or noodles for a complete meal. Enjoy!
